• F4L912 engine oil cooler radiator 2234409 04237803 4237803 02234409

F4L912 engine oil cooler radiator 2234409 04237803 4237803 02234409

US$ 34 - 36 / Piece
1 Piece(Min. Order)
  • T/T Credit Card